Output 41100b6368934284a23b58035a0077b28b3cb49a06196af8c17e39eefa455182:0

value
3500348999
script pubkey
OP_0 OP_PUSHBYTES_20 77cf20b6e2e5ddd753c0915556841a570fa504ae
address
tb1qwl8jpdhzuhwaw57qj924dpq62u862p9w7jajjh
transaction
41100b6368934284a23b58035a0077b28b3cb49a06196af8c17e39eefa455182